Elgar B. Holliday
Incident
Border Patrol Inspector Elgar Holliday suffered a fatal heart attack following three straight days of rescue efforts in the lower Rio Grande Valley, Texas, following Hurricane Beulah. On the third day, he began to suffer chest pains and checked into a hospital where he was diagnosed with heart failure due to over-exertion. He remained in the hospital until his death in October. Inspector Holliday had served with the United States Border Patrol for 12 years. He was survived by his wife. He was buried in the Pebbles Cemetery in Livingston, Polk County, Texas.
